"Hurricane Hilary wreaks havoc in Southern California, causing closures and warnings"

As San Diego prepares for the arrival of Storm Hilary, a number of state parks, beaches, businesses, and public facilities will be closed or canceled. State beaches, inland state parks, and the Cabrillo National Monument will be closed due to flooding concerns. The City of San Diego is closing all public facilities, including libraries, rec centers, and beaches. The San Diego Zoo Safari Park, Del Mar Race Track, SeaWorld San Diego, and several farmers markets will also be closed. Additionally, the city's reservoir lakes will be closed, San Diego State University will hold virtual classes, and Amtrak Pacific Surfliner trains have been canceled. The Oceanside Pier and beach walkway will be closed, and the America's Finest City Half Marathon & 5K has been canceled.
